Before delving deeper into answering the question “How do I find SEO backlinks? There are three main categories of SEO backlinks:
- Natural Backlinks: These occur organically when other websites link to your content because they find it valuable.
- Manual Backlinks: These are acquired through deliberate outreach and relationship-building efforts.
- Self-Created Backlinks: These are links that you create yourself, such as forum signatures or blog comments. While they may offer some value, they’re often considered low-quality by search engines.

1. Competitor Analysis
To kickstart your backlink acquisition strategy, consider analyzing the backlink profiles of your competitors. Utilizing tools such as Ahrefs or SEMrush can offer valuable insights into the websites that are linking to your competitors. Pay close attention to high-authority sites within your industry or niche, as they often hold the most potential for enhancing your own site’s authority and visibility.
Once you’ve identified these key players, explore various avenues for collaboration or outreach.
This could involve reaching out to webmasters or content creators to propose guest posting opportunities, partnerships, or other forms of collaboration that mutually benefit both parties. By strategically leveraging your competitors’ backlink profiles and forging connections with relevant authoritative sites, you can strengthen your own backlink profile and improve your website’s search engine rankings and overall visibility.

3. Broken Link Building
One effective strategy for acquiring backlinks is to search for broken links on high-authority websites within your niche. Broken links, also known as 404 errors, can negatively impact a website’s user experience and SEO performance. By identifying these broken links and offering a solution, you can provide value to website owners while gaining a backlink for your own site.
Start by using tools like Ahrefs or SEMrush to identify high-authority websites in your niche that have broken links. Once you’ve identified a relevant broken link, reach out to the website owner or webmaster with a polite email. In your message, inform them about the broken link and provide the URL of the specific page on their site where the broken link is located.
Suggest replacing the broken link with a link to your relevant content that offers similar or complementary information. Emphasize how your content adds value to their website and enhances the user experience for their visitors. By offering a helpful solution to their broken link issue, you increase the likelihood of them accepting your proposal and providing a valuable backlink to your site.
4. Resource Page Outreach
Identifying resource pages relevant to your industry is a strategic approach to acquiring quality backlinks. These pages often serve as curated collections of valuable content, making them prime opportunities for link building. Start by conducting research to find resource pages within your niche. You can use search engines and tools like Ahrefs or SEMrush to identify websites that maintain such pages.
Once you’ve compiled a list of potential resource pages, reach out to the site owners or webmasters with a personalized email. Introduce yourself and your website, and explain why your content would be a valuable addition to their resource page. Highlight the relevance and quality of your content, emphasizing how it aligns with the theme and focus of their page.
Be sure to customize each outreach email to the specific website and resource page you’re targeting. Personalization demonstrates your genuine interest and increases the likelihood of a positive response. By securing placements on relevant resource pages, you can earn valuable backlinks that enhance your site’s authority and visibility within your industry.
